Pit firing. The original method for "baking" clay. It dates back to nearly 30,000 years ago. Typically done in a hole or pit in the ground, the pots are placed in and burned. SAGGARSA saggar is a boxlike container used in the firing of pottery to protect ware in kilns. They are used to safeguard ware from open flames, smoke, gases and kiln debris. They are typically ceramics. However, there are foil and paper saggars, which are made of foil and paper (respectively).

Pinterest board for vessel project: here To make my vessel, I took a slab of clay and rolled it out using the slab roller. Then, out of the flat clay, I cut a rectangle out. The rectangle was made into a cylindrical shape. A small circle was cut out of the flat clay as well and then Score n' Slip'd to the bottom of the cylinder. The handle wa smade out of a small piece of clay, slightly rectangular in shape, which was bent to provide a curve. The petals were added on, along with the thorns and leaves. After this was fired, then it was glazed, providing what there is now Also, I made a small bowl-like thing. This was a fun project to do, and fairly simple.. Though it did take a while.
